Studies have been made on the in vitro incorporation of 3H-leucine into insulin-like protein of the submaxillary glands and pancreatic insulin of mice. The effect of glucose on the intensity of incorporation of the labeled leucine into these proteins was also investigated. In was shown that during incubation of the submaxillary glands in the medium containing 3H-leucine, isotope is incorporated into the insulin-like protein, this fact indicating that this protein is synthesized in the glands. The increase in the content of glucose in the medium increases the incorporation of 3H-leucine into pancreatic insulin by 4 times, into insulin-like protein--by 5 times.
